Let’s assume a company determines that its value of electrical energy and provides will differ by approximately $10 for each machine hour (MH) used. It additionally is aware of that different prices are fastened costs of roughly $40,000 per month. Based on this data, the versatile price range for every month can be $40,000 + $10 per MH.

For example, for example an organization had a static finances for sales commissions whereby the company’s administration allotted $50,000 to pay the sales staff a fee. Regardless of the entire gross sales volume–whether it was $100,000 or $1,000,000–the commissions per worker would be divided by the $50,000 static-budget amount.

All expense ranges maintain regular no matter what the true world outcomes are. Now let’s illustrate the flexible finances by utilizing completely different ranges of volume. If 5,000 machine hours had been necessary for the month of January, the flexible budget for January will be $90,000 ($40,000 mounted + $10 x 5,000 MH). If the machine hours in February are 6,300 hours, then the flexible price range for February shall be $103,000 ($40,000 fixed + $10 x 6,300 MH).
